"Brian J. Murrell" <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> writes:

> I lost a bunch of mails this morning!  Why?  Because the exact same
> problem I complained about the last time sendmail was updated happened
> again.
> 
> PLEASE FIX THIS!!
> 
> The sendmail binary that gets installed is incapable of writing into
the
> spool (/var/spool/mqueue) directory when executed as a non-privilleged
> user.  Somebody please look at the "make install" for sendmail and
make
> sure that whatever permissions it wants to set on the senamail binary
> actually make into the package.

ok gonna to fix this, sendmail was not suid which is good for security
but not in our case :p
